Latest Patents

Strasser's latest patents include a "Zirconium dioxide green body with color and translucency gradients." This invention relates to a sintered molding with a color gradient, specifically designed for the manufacture of dental restorations. The process involves sintering a compression-molded element made up of five or more different ceramic powder layers, each containing at least two different base powders, with a minimum of 80 wt. % ZrO.

Another significant patent is the "Method of manufacturing a zirconium dioxide green body with color and translucency gradients." This method outlines the steps for creating a ceramic molding by layering three or more ceramic powder layers, each with distinct compositions. Each layer comprises a mixture of at least two different base powders, ensuring that at least 80 wt. % ZrO and at least 0.02 wt. % AlO are present.

Career Highlights

Christian Strasser is currently employed at Vita Zahnfabrik H. Rauter GmbH & Co. KG, a company renowned for its advancements in dental materials. His work focuses on enhancing the aesthetic and functional properties of dental restorations through innovative ceramic technologies.
